𝐀𝐕𝐎𝐈𝐃𝐈𝐍𝐆 𝐒𝐂𝐀𝐍𝐃𝐀𝐋 𝐀𝐃𝐃𝐄𝐃 𝐀 bit of fun to their dark-cycle life. With every meetup, it was like a rush of doing something they weren't supposed to even if they technically weren't–at least not yet.

Skywing was a little confused about what seemed to change this dark-cycle. She enjoyed his company, though if she admitted that out loud, she feared his ego might overflow. 

She'd keep the information to herself for now.

But enjoying his company didn't mean doing anything bizarre. To her, she enjoyed the two sitting in silence or chatting about random things in the Observatory. She also enjoyed flying with him, even if she had to carry the mech and avoid patrols. It was fun to watch him keep up with her when he decided he wanted to run or drive along after her.

It was casual, it was easy, and it felt real. That's what she loved about it. It was like a fresh canvas on top of hers that was practically peeling with the amount of layers on it.

But now she was more than a little confused when Neo told her he wanted to do something different. He had caught her interest, a genuine curiosity luring the femme to follow the mech to do something else in that dark-cycle.

Normally their activities didn't draw much attention, for the most part, but this was certainly...attention-grabbing.

First, it was the fact that he took her to get some energon at a much too fancy place. It drew more optics than she would've liked, nor was she used to after being pretty restricted on Vos.

She thought that might've been the end of it, but her amused confusion continued as he insistently began trying to buy her things. It was relentless, not even looking at the price before he'd be shut down by her.

He was shut down yet again when he suggested an appearance at a party or two he had been invited to as the celebrity gladiator he was.

By then, annoyance creeping into her systems, she flew them up to a rooftop, much to his confusion, shaking her helm. "Alright, what's going on?"

"What do you mean?" Neo replied with his usual casualness, the act he'd been trying to uphold prevailing.

"Your many attempts..." she clarified with little room for denial, watching him falter, "If you truly believe that that was the best way to impress me, you're deeply mistaken."

His expression hardened slightly, and only for a moment did his mask falter as the femme in front of him furrowed her optic-ridges in determination.

"Let me make this clear. I have the things I need. I don't need you to flaunt what you have. What I need, you haven't been able to show me you're capable of handling it. I have bots to protect, duties to uphold, so I don't have time for your games." Her glyphs were fast-spoken, each a little faster than the next as her frustration and lack of patience were quite audible.

Her glyphs were like a puzzle, not entirely clear or vague but she didn't know that he had all the pieces.  He had been annoyingly paying attention to everything he could, as she could always feel his optics.

"Why would you keep me around if I'm so...time-consuming?" Neo smirked almost knowingly as they stared one another down, neither willing to back down or step away.
